- [ ] Key ceremony, step 3 (for external plugin authors): verify the EXIF-scrubbing module before signing. The Snapveil host strips GPS, device, and timestamp tags from every uploaded image prior to plugin access; your plugin must not attempt to re-read raw metadata. Confirm the scrubber's signed manifest matches the ceremony sheet, then countersign. Unlocking the manifest archive requires the recovery passphrase, which appears on the following line.

strongbox words: wenix-ulador

## Break-Glass Access: Firmware Update Channel

If the Larkspur OTA signing service is unreachable, the release manager may push firmware through the emergency channel on the Veldt console. This bypasses staged rollout, so use it only for critical device faults. Unlock the emergency channel with the recovery passphrase below, then file an incident within one hour.

recovery phrase for bawef-haduf: wenax-druox-julmir

Handover Note — Director Transition

Per board request: the Quillane product line enters retirement phasing in Q3. Inventory drawdown at the Verrow Falls plant is on schedule, and customer migration to Quillane-Next is 60% complete. Marit Oslund will assume vendor wind-down duties. The confidential outline of next-phase plans follows below.

board note of yadup-fajef: Druiusox Holdings is in early talks to buy Norwynek Systems for about $186.0 million. The Kaseth launch date is June 24, and nothing goes to the press before then. Legal wants the Quenethek Group term sheet withdrawn before November 27.